Energy Retrofit Systems Market Is Expected to Cross USD 176.11 Billion by 2025 : Analysis by Top Players: Schneider Electric, Ameresco Inc, Eaton, AECOM, Daikin Industrie

The energy retrofit systems market is projected to grow at a CAGR of 12.6%, in terms of value, from 2017 to reach USD 176.11 Billion by 2025.

Rising adoption of advanced technologies is the major factor which is anticipated to drive the growth of energy retrofit systems in this region. Urbanization, industrialization and construction of new infrastructures in Asia Pacific region are some of the major contributors to the expected growth of energy retrofit systems in Asia Pacific region during the forecast period. Developing economies such as India and China are anticipated to be the major contributor in the growth of Energy Retrofit Systems in Asia Pacific Region.

In September 2018, Ameresco Inc. announced acquiring Chelsea Group Limited a Hawaii-based building science and design engineering consulting firm with specialization in preserving and enhancing the mechanical infrastructure of commercial, institutional, retail and industrial facilities. Through the acquisition, the company aims to expand its energy solutions and customer base in Hawaii. Recently, the company announced the successful completion of a project serving the municipal government buildings of Stewart County, Tennessee.

Energy Retrofit Systems Market-O-Nomics:
- The global revenue of HVAC system market is expected to cross USD 200 billion by 2020
- The total cost allocated for building or upgrading buildings are 20% building costs and 80% operating
costs where 40% operating costs comes from energy, 30% maintenance and 10% from other costs
- Globally, the total energy consumption by commercial and residential segment is estimated to be around
35-45%
- The major factors driving this segment are increasing demand for building automation systems, adoption
of technological advances like IoT and growing awareness for energy efficient systems
- The HVAC retrofit systems accounted for 22% of the total market in 2017
- The average wattage consumption of15 Watt CFL or 60 Watt incandescent bulbs is approximately 7 Watt
which could be reduced to 5 Watt using equivalent wattage of LED retrofit bulb. This provides a scope
for potential energy and cost saving. The LED retrofit bulb's operational cost is only 25% of the
incandescent bulbs
- The demand for LED retrofit in annual replacement business has grown significantly during 2012-2016.
The annual replacement business can be segmented into – installed base fixtures, installed base light
sources and light sources consumed for replacement. The percentage growths from 2012 to 2016 in each
of these segments are approximately 460%, 819% and 592% respectively
- The residential segmented in the energy retrofit systems market was valued at USD 33.05 Billion in
2016
